150 Surat Pilgrims Still Missing in Calamity-Struck Uttarakhand

SURAT: The District Collectorate of Surat and Surat’s Disaster Management Cell has so far collated information about 674 pilgrims from Surat who have got stuck in the calamity-hit Uttarakhand. Of them 541 are from Surat city, 76 fromBardoli, 13 from Choryasi, 15 from Kamrej, 17 from Palsana, 5 each from Olpad and Mangroland 2 from Mahuataluka of the district.

"We were able to get in touch with some of these people in Uttarakhand, especially those who had gone in groups or organized tours. However, we are still to get in touch with about 150 people. The state disaster control in Uttarakhand has been provided with their details," district collector Jayprakash Shivhare said.

Surat Regional Transport Office (RTO) had issued permits to Jay Bhavani Travels, Gurukripa Travels, Chamunda Travels and Nita Travels for their respective tours to Uttarakhand. However, Nita Travels, which took 50 passengers to that state on tour, only returned on Thursday.

"We have no information about smaller groups or families that may have gone to Uttarakhand on their own," said an official from the district collectorate.
